Transaction 8dda77d434475584bfd3f35cdf10dc0e784854b76abc5462edf34b8bafcfc758
1 Input
1 Output
-
8dda77d434475584bfd3f35cdf10dc0e784854b76abc5462edf34b8bafcfc758:0
- value
- 250000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 720d3fe89081702f4dd2f8a68c9c3e06deb55620 OP_EQUAL
- address
- 3C64q1kPcdqxuAJrDBCTkhMnBjuckGgEHi